    Every Sunday night we go to a club call Escobar, and I always see alot of local celebs there. Well, this past Sunday I met Dominick Davis and Cat Mobley there. I have met Cat a handful of time back in the when he was a rookie, him and Barkley were at the Roxy EVERY Tuesday night back then. Anyways, I told Cat glad to see him again and then we briefly talked about where he would paly next season and Stevie too. He laughed about the subject, but made it sound like he would NOT be back in Sacramento and sounded like he would go where the money was...lol By the way, he kept a napkin tightly wrapped over his drinks the whole night, guess he wants to make sure no one ever slips something in his glass.     They have Boozer (6yr 70mil) and Okur (6yr 50mil) that signed just last year, and add to that Kirilenko's extension (86 mil for 6 years) and harpring and giricek's MLE type contract. There's no way they can give him a "big" offer.
